Hey guys,
I am transferring up to Buff State from community college and I was wondering more about suites. On my campus tour I saw a normal dorm but did not get to see a suite. How do they compare? What is the layout like? I noticed the dorm was kind of dingy, are the suites nicer? Of course the best thing would be pics or maps, but even a good description from someone living in one would be great.

A lot of the dorms have been recently renovated, so they should not be as dingy as the freshmen dorms that you probably saw. I lived in the North Wing my freshman year, which has suites for international and honors students, as well as some sports teams. My suite had four bedrooms (two people per bedroom), a common area, and a bathroom. There is definitely some more privacy than in a regular dorm, so I would highly recommend it if you have the option.
